How can a tyre inflate itself?

I recently bought a used car. When I checked the tyre pressure, one of the tyres was over inflated by 16psi. I let the air out to the correct pressure, then checked them all again a week later. The same tyre had increased in pressure by 6psi. How can it possilby be inflating itself? Any possible explanation would be greatly appreciated. I've never come across anything like it before.

Chances are it's the gauge thats reading differently. Tyres can't self inflate. They can move up by a couple of pounds when hot. You should check them cold at the same place with the same gauge. DIY push on guages aren't 100% reliable, use one at a garage.
